CALL FOR PAPERS — RN27 MIDTERM CONFERENCE

CALL FOR PAPERS:
The theme “Territories, communities and sustainability: views from Southern Europe” is a challenging approach to study the links between different areas of knowledge, inviting interdisciplinary outlooks to sociologists and other social scientists interested in environment, development and educational issues.
This can be a particularly relevant reflection in the post-pandemic phase of current times, highlighting regional and local features of a global experience. It allows comparing Southern European societies, between themselves but also with other European (and non-European) societies, and therefore, providing insights to better understand each geographic and cultural area.

Participants are invited to discuss the actual role of communities and the linkages with territories, the social and cultural dynamics, and institutional foundations of Southern Europe, to understand current challenges and dilemmas specifically linked to territories and communities living on them.
Papers with a comparative focus between countries of Southern Europe, other parts of Europe, the Mediterranean area and beyond are especially encouraged, as well as specific studies at country and regional level that provide general implications for the whole region.
